Newcells Biotech is based at the world-renowned Centre for Life in Newcastle-Upon-Tyne, UK. The company was founded in 2014 as a spin out biotechnology company from Newcastle University. The company is founded on the technology and expertise of one of the UK's leading centres for stem cell biology and located alongside one of the largest research-intensive medical university and hospital complexes in the UK. NEW THINKING Human induced pluripotent stem cell (hiPSC) lines are fast becoming instrumental in advances in disease modelling, drug development and drug toxicity. By delivering the "best in biology" human tissue samples and converting these lines into specific cell types, we can significantly improve the unpredictable and costly global drug discovery process. NEW APPROACHES Using our hiPSC and cell biology technology, we create differentiated cells and incorporate them into novel pre-clinical assays covering both human and other key species. NEW OPPORTUNITIES We have the expertise to collaborate with multidisciplinary teams in industry and academia. We are experts in developing cells of the retina, kidney, immune system and skin – making not just simple models, but complex miniature organs to mimic in-vivo human physiology. NEW DISCOVERIES Working with ethically sourced patient samples we can build in-vitro models of diseases to accelerate exploration of targets and new chemical entities.
